What Does Pass Grade Mean in Nigerian Polytechnic?

In most Nigerian polytechnics, Pass falls within a CGPA range of 2.00 to 2.49 on a 4.00 grading scale. This means the student successfully completed all required courses but did not achieve the benchmark for Lower Credit or Upper Credit.

Failure occurs when a student cannot meet graduation requirements. Pass confirms completion of academic obligations and qualifies you as an ND holder. The distinction between Pass and other classifications mainly affects progression opportunities, not the validity of your diploma.

Pass vs Lower Credit: Is There a Big Difference?

Lower Credit usually ranges from 2.50 to 2.99 CGPA. That higher classification provides smoother access to HND programs and Direct Entry admission into universities. Some institutions clearly state Lower Credit as their minimum requirement.

Pass holders may need additional qualifications, relevant work experience, or internal screening before being admitted into certain programs. The difference lies more in competitive access than in the legitimacy of the qualification.

Does Pass Grade Affect HND Admission?

Many polytechnics prefer Lower Credit for HND admission. Pass applicants are sometimes required to present evidence of industrial experience or complete remedial programs before being considered.

Admission policies vary across institutions. Private polytechnics and some state institutions may apply more flexible criteria.

Candidates determined to pursue HND should contact their preferred institution directly, confirm requirements, and prepare supporting documents such as IT completion letters and recommendation letters.

Does Pass Grade Affect Job Opportunities in Nigeria?

Recruitment practices differ across industries. Government agencies and structured graduate trainee programs often use CGPA benchmarks during screening. In such cases, Pass grade may limit automatic eligibility.

Private-sector employers frequently prioritize competence, technical skills, and work experience. A candidate who demonstrates ability through practical projects can compete effectively regardless of classification.

Technology companies, creative agencies, renewable energy firms, and entrepreneurial ventures often focus more on productivity than on CGPA.

Limitations of Pass Grade

Certain competitive scholarships and postgraduate programs require stronger academic classifications. Structured corporate programs may screen applicants using CGPA cut-offs.

Academic progression into HND or Direct Entry may require additional steps compared to Lower Credit graduates.

Can ND Pass Holders Still Convert to Degree?

ND Pass holders can pursue degree conversion through Direct Entry, top-up programs, private universities, IJMB, JUPEB, or distance learning pathways. Some institutions require additional qualifications or work experience before admission.

Performance during degree studies often overshadows earlier ND classification. Strong academic results at the Bachelor’s level can open postgraduate and scholarship opportunities later.
